Spip · Spip · CVE-2006-0517
**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ions** SPIP versions 1.8.2-e and earlier SPIP versions 1.9 Alpha 2 and earlier **Description** The issue all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ands. This can be achieved via the `id forum`, `id article`, or `id breve` parameters to "forum.php3", unspecified vectors related to session handling, and when posting petitions. **Recommendations** For SPIP versions 1.8.2-e and earlier, avoid using the `id forum`, `id article`, and `id breve` parameters in the "forum.php3" endpoint until the issue is resolved. For SPIP versions 1.9 Alpha 2 and earlier, consider restricting access to session handling and petition posting functionality to minimize the risk of exploitation. At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
